Directions
- 1. Slice the berries and toss them with the sugar (or agave) and honey, and let them macerate for one hour at room temperature.
- 2. Puree the berries and their liquid with the rice milk, lemon juice and liquor, if using, with a standard or immersion blender.
- You can puree it until completely smooth and strain out some or all of the seeds by pressing the mixture through a mesh sieve. Or you can leave it slightly chunky and omit straining it.
- 3. Taste, and add more lemon juice or liquor*, if desired.
- 4. Chill thoroughly, then freeze in your ice cream maker according to the manufacturer’s instructions. *You can add up to 3 tablespoons of liquor to this ice cream; the alcohol softens the texture so the more you add, the less-hard the ice cream will get. You can find more tips at the links below.
